删除6位数后的纬度和经度分数部分

Sun*_*nny 3 android latitude-longitude

我得到这种格式的lat和long

Latitude23.132679999999997,经度72.20081833333333

但我想以这种格式

纬度= 23.132680,经度72.200818

我怎么能转换

MAC*_*MAC 6

double d=23.132679999999997;
DecimalFormat dFormat = new DecimalFormat("#.######"); 

d= Double.valueOf(dFormat .format(d));
Run Code Online (Sandbox Code Playgroud)


Sha*_*lik 6

double Latitude = 23.132679999999997;
int precision =  Math.pow(10, 6);
double new_Latitude = double((int)(precision * Latitude))/precision;
Run Code Online (Sandbox Code Playgroud)

这将只给出小数点后的6位数.